(Japanese: エクスプローラーズからの果たし状 A Letter of Challenge from the Explorers) is the 43rd episode of Pokémon Horizons: The Series, and the 1,275th episode of the Pokémon anime. It first aired in Japan on March 15, 2024.

Trivia
- For the initial airing of this episode, Professor Friede's Pokémon Seminar was replaced by a preview of the next two episodes and a preview of the next arc, Pocket Monsters: Terastal Debut.
- The first eyecatch features Sidian and his Garganacl, and the second features Coral and her Glalie.
- This episode marks the first time that a first partner Pokémon revealed its Ability since Clemont's Chespin revealed its ability in An Appetite for Battle!, 461 episodes earlier.
